Eye Allergies

Understanding and Managing Eye Allergies in Monroe, NY

Eye allergies are a common problem for many people, causing redness, itching, watering, and discomfort. Also called allergic conjunctivitis, eye allergies occur when your eyes overreact to triggers such as pollen, dust, pet dander, or mold. Common Symptoms of Eye Allergies

Eye allergies can range from mild irritation to severe discomfort. Typical symptoms include:

  • Red or bloodshot eyes
  • Itching or burning sensations
  • Excessive tearing or watery eyes
  • Swelling around the eyelids
  • Sensitivity to light
  • A feeling of grittiness or “something in the eye”
